HC is unburned fuel. Could be caused by lots of things but most often it's related to misfire. Is this the two speed idle test or ASM Loaded Mode? What are the other gas numbers?

Also if the cat is original it's likely shot by now. The HC level isn't all that high so either the cat is bad or it's doing a heck of a job covering up some other problem like lean misfire. The EVAP system could be faulty too. Without the other gas numbers it's difficult to know.

Diluted oil can cause elevated HC to some extent as can an impropely operating PCV system. You may want to change the oil again but in my experience oil isn't usually the culprit.

As for the other gases CO2 is an indicator of combustion efficieny. With a correctly operating engine/converter it should be high, around 14-15%. O2 and CO should be around half a percent. CO and O2 are inversely proportional in that a lean mixture will be high in O2 while a rich one will be low. Vice-versa on the CO. With those numbers I could calculate what your lambda (and thus your mixture) is. Since you were doing a 2 speed idle test NOx wasn't measured so it's unimportant. The bottom line is as long as the cat is fed a stoichiometric mixture and is working emissions will be at a minimum.

Tune the van up and confirm the engine is operating in closed loop with the O2 sensor cross counting. The catalyst depends on this flip flopping of the exhaust stream to operate. (I'm assuming it's a three way cat). However, a good cat will mask upstream engine problems while suffering a reduction in service life because of them. It's why changing the converter just to pass is a bad idea unless it can be proven the engine out exhaust stream is correct.

Leaky valves and bad timing can also cause high HC. As previously mentioned if the vehicle has an EVAP system it should be checked. Replace the catalyst only after everything else has been verified and be sure it's "lit" (hot) just prior to doing the next test. Good luck.

NOX is only generated under load so there is nothing to measure unless the test is done on a dyno.

You have lots of good advice here. Don't forget that high HC is from unburned gasoline (raw fuel) and is from ineffecient combustion.

PCv valve, hose and grommet won't benefit from ARX. They're usally $2-3 each so I change them
if they're old or don't work. Look at the hood above the PCV valve for oil and dirt to show leak, look at the valve cover around the grommet for oil and dirt to show the grommet has petrified from soft sealing rubber, look at the hose for age , cracks and blockage.
